Nicorandil 5 mg
MAYORANDIL 5 is a cardiovascular medication containing Nicorandil 5 mg, widely prescribed for the prevention and long-term management of angina pectoris (chest pain) associated with coronary artery disease. Angina occurs when the heart muscle does not receive enough oxygen-rich blood, usually due to narrowing or blockage of the coronary arteries. Nicorandil works through a unique dual mechanism to improve blood flow to the heart, thereby reducing the frequency and severity of angina attacks.
Nicorandil belongs to a class of medicines known as vasodilators. It acts both as a nitrate-like agent and a potassium channel opener, helping relax and widen blood vessels. This dual action reduces the workload on the heart and enhances oxygen delivery to cardiac muscles. MAYORANDIL 5 is often recommended for patients who do not achieve adequate symptom control with conventional anti-anginal therapies or who require additional cardiovascular protection.
With regular use under medical supervision, MAYORANDIL 5 plays a significant role in improving exercise tolerance, reducing chest pain episodes, and enhancing overall quality of life in patients with chronic stable angina.
Uses
MAYORANDIL 5 is primarily used for the following medical indications:
Chronic Stable Angina: Helps prevent and reduce episodes of chest pain caused by reduced blood flow to the heart.
Angina Prophylaxis: Used as a long-term preventive treatment rather than for immediate relief of acute chest pain.
Coronary Artery Disease: Supports improved coronary blood circulation in patients with narrowed or blocked arteries.
Adjunct Therapy: May be prescribed along with beta-blockers, calcium channel blockers, or other anti-anginal medications when single-drug therapy is insufficient.
Improvement of Exercise Capacity: Helps patients perform daily physical activities with reduced chest discomfort.
MAYORANDIL 5 is not intended for the rapid relief of an ongoing angina attack but is highly effective for long-term angina management.

Dosage
The dosage of MAYORANDIL 5 should always be determined by a qualified healthcare professional based on the patient’s condition and response to treatment. General dosage guidelines include:
Initial Dose: Often starts with 5 mg taken twice daily.
Maintenance Dose: The dose may be gradually increased depending on clinical response and tolerance.
Administration: Tablets should be swallowed whole with water, preferably at the same times each day.
Consistency: Regular intake is essential for optimal preventive benefits.
Dose Adjustment: Elderly patients or those with low blood pressure may require cautious dose titration.
Patients should never adjust the dose on their own. Strict adherence to the prescribed regimen helps ensure maximum effectiveness and safety.
Side Effects
Like all medications, MAYORANDIL 5 may cause side effects in some individuals, although many patients tolerate it well.
Common Side Effects
Headache (especially at the beginning of therapy)
Dizziness or lightheadedness
Flushing
Nausea
Fatigue
Less Common or Serious Side Effects
Low blood pressure (hypotension)
Mouth or gastrointestinal ulcers (rare but characteristic of Nicorandil)
Palpitations
Skin rash or allergic reactions
Most mild side effects, such as headache, often decrease as the body adjusts to the medication. Patients experiencing severe, persistent, or unusual symptoms should seek medical advice promptly.
Precautions and Warning
Before starting MAYORANDIL 5, certain precautions should be carefully considered:
Hypotension Risk: Use with caution in patients with low blood pressure or those taking other blood pressure–lowering medications.
Heart Conditions: Inform your doctor if you have heart failure, recent heart attack, or rhythm disorders.
Liver or Kidney Disease: Dose adjustments may be necessary in patients with organ impairment.
Drug Interactions: Avoid concurrent use with phosphodiesterase inhibitors (such as medications used for erectile dysfunction), as this may cause severe hypotension.
Pregnancy and Breastfeeding: Use only if clearly prescribed by a healthcare professional.
Driving and Machinery: Dizziness may occur, especially at the start of treatment; caution is advised.
MAYORANDIL 5 should be used strictly under medical supervision to ensure safe and effective long-term therapy.
